2009-07-30 33 views
0

我想阻止從一個特定的IP地址訪問我的網站,我該怎麼做。?如何阻止我的網站從一個已知的IP地址?

使用htaccess或?

+0

您需要指定是否要在代碼(以及哪種語言)中或通過服務器執行此操作。最好通過服務器,如果是的話,這個需求轉移到服務器故障 – 2009-07-30 16:50:59

回答

1

關閉我的頭頂,在.htaccess,把下面的

order allow,deny 
allow from all 
deny from 10.my.ip.address 

不是100%肯定,所以請讓我知道它的工作。

1

如果您使用的是PHP,請將其放入您的配置文件中。根據需要替換字符串和變量以更改IP地址或仇恨等級。

<?php 
$ip = 255.255.255.255; 
if($_SERVER['REMOTE_ADDR'] == $IP) 
{ 
    die("I Hate You"); 
} 
?> 

我喜歡這一個:

 
    $ip = 255.255.255.255; 
    if($_SERVER['REMOTE_ADDR'] == $IP) 
    { 
     $array = array("I", "Hate", "You", "Alot"); 
     $message = $array[rand(0,3)]; 
     die($message); 
    } 

如果他們刷新頁面不夠,他們可能會發現我在說什麼。